Binary package hint: xserver-xorg-driver-ati

When I switch between virtual X screens with ctrl+alt+arrow, sometimes
the entire system freezes totally. It does not respond to keys or mouse,
any music playing is stopped etc. The windows on the old desktop are
cleared and the new ones are drawn with their widget background colors,
but they don't contain any graphics or other content. Sometimes this
happens several times per day, but sometimes everything works fine for
days.

I have been unable to trigger this bug in any other way than switching
between virtual desktops.

I have a Thinkpad T30 with the following graphics chip:

0000:01:00.0 VGA compatible controller: ATI Technologies Inc Radeon
Mobility M7 LW [Radeon Mobility 7500]
